What is PIM software?

Product Information Management (PIM) software provides businesses with the tools to manage substantial product information in a centralized database. 

The product data is collected, named, described, and categorized in keeping with market and industry standards. With a PIM, you can do so much more than just create a product and its description. You can upload universal products from their source of origin, attach pricing structures, add marketing information, record sales history, and even add information in a variety of languages.

1. Data consolidation and accuracy

PIM systems facilitate the addition of products to a centralized database, where the quality and complexity of product information can be efficiently administered. By maintaining data in a single location, you can organize your stock holding, standardize information such as product numbers and descriptions, analyze and regulate the many products, and store large amounts of relevant information. Data storage in a typical PIM system includes:

  • SKUs, product codes, names, and descriptions.
  • Technical information such as size, weight, color, and material composition.
  • Detailed pricing and discount structures.
  • Categorization
  • Relationships between products in bills of material or product bundles.
  • Shipping information and requirements.
  • Certification details
  • Marketing channel
  • information: SEO, specific product descriptions and preferences.
  • Historical information 
  • Digital material: product images, CAD designs, videos, PDF manuals, and more.
  • Secondary descriptions and content information in alternate languages.

2. Multichannel sharing and integration

A PIM system facilitates integration with your company’s internal systems, such as the ERP and WMS systems, as well as external systems that include manufacturers, retailers, and logistics companies. When Dealing with companies across the supply chain, it makes sense to deal with one standard product database throughout the process. This avoids unnecessary data disorganization and duplication,  along with lost work effort managing that of information and speeds up your sales and procurement processes. 

3. Increased efficiency and a reduced time-to-market

A PIM system that allows import and updates of product details from the manufacturer or supplier will save you a lot of time as product numbers, descriptions, categories, specifications, barcodes, and more are automatically uploaded. Products created by manufacturers or suppliers should comply with existing industry and state regulations where applicable, reducing the need for additional administration work.

Theoretically, all you should have to do is add your own pricing and discount structures to the products, and they will be ready to sell. You can reduce the tedious capturing of new products and error-checking. You can capture marketing information, such as geographical or customer preferences, or upload the information from your ERP and CRM systems.

Improved efficiency naturally leads to a more stable database that requires a minimum of intervention. This means that your products reach the marketplace a lot sooner, giving you the edge over competitors that are still battling with older legacy systems.

5. Analytics and reporting

Essential features of any system are data analytics and reporting. When it comes to PIM systems, algorithms can be used to detect duplication, inconsistencies, and errors. 

The data analytics function provides statistics on product movement and can assist with forecasting future buying needs. With the help of analysis and predictive software, your nightmares about over- or under-stocking should be a thing of the past. 

6. Scalability

As you onboard new product ranges your customer base should increase too, and this means that in time you will need a system that can grow with your business. Cloud-based solutions facilitate the storage of large volumes of data for the inevitable expansion of your database.

In the dynamic e-commerce space, buying trends are constantly changing and evolving, leading to stock obsolescence and a need to replace old products with new ones. An ever-growing database will eventually slow the response times, causing delays and customer frustration.

Based on usage statistics and analytics, a PIM system will make it easy for you to flag products that are no longer viable and facilitate the creation of new catalogs as your system grows.

With a PIM solution, you can link old and new products for a seamless replacement on your e-commerce platform. You can flag old products so that they are not reordered but still accept customer returns on the old product.

8. Multilingual efficiency

When doing business across borders, it’s important to present your products in the relevant languages. There may also be slight nuances required when presenting your products to different audiences across the globe. A PIM facilitates the translation of product descriptions into various languages and enables you to capture the different cultural nuances for presentation to your customers.

9. Product variants

The product variant feature in PIM allows you to build links between similar products so that you can offer browsing customers a more suitable alternative. Products can be linked based on different sizes, colours, pricing, or materials. This improves your chances of making a sale and broadening your customer base.
